Local Authority Housing Rents

Dáil Éireann Debate, Tuesday - 6 November 2012

Tuesday, 6 November 2012

Questions (678, 690)

Tom Fleming

Question:

678. Deputy Tom Fleming asked the Minister for the Environment, Community and Local Government the number of households that acquired council housing loans that were in arrears in each local authority in 2008, 2009, 2010, 2011 and to date in 2012;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[47702/12]

View answer

Tom Fleming

Question:

690. Deputy Tom Fleming asked the Minister for the Environment, Community and Local Government the number of households with council housing loans that were in arrears in each local authority in 2008, 2009, 2010, 2011 and to date in 2012; the total number that were in arrears for each year;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[47713/12]

View answer

Written answers

I propose to take Questions Nos. 678 and 690 together.

My Department collates and publishes a wide range of housing and planning statistics that inform the preparation and evaluation of policy and those data are available on my Department’s website www.environ.ie .

Since 2010, data are collected from local authorities on the number of loans in arrears broken down by the length of time in arrears. The data to mid-2012 indicate that 6,280 such loans are in arrears of more than 90 days , which represents 28% of the total number of loans. The data are provided in a tabular format below.
